Optimized downlink transmit power control during soft handover in WCDMA systems

This paper proposes a new power control strategy during soft handover in WCDMA systems. According to the link qualities of the downlink channels involved in soft handover, the transmit powers of the base stations in the active set are dynamically allocated. This new optimized power control scheme reduces the additional interference caused by the multiple site transmission during soft handover. Compared with the unbalanced and balanced power control scheme adopted by 3GPP, the proposed scheme shows better performance. It increases the downlink capacity and makes the whole system more robust to the fluctuating attenuation of the radio environment.
